技术博客
惊喜好礼享不停
技术博客
Referencer文献管理软件:提高写作效率的利器

Referencer文献管理软件:提高写作效率的利器

作者: 万维易源
2024-08-27
ReferencerGnome文献管理代码示例实用性

摘要

Referencer是一款专门为Gnome桌面环境设计的文献管理软件,它极大地提升了用户在学术研究和文档整理方面的效率。为了帮助用户更好地掌握并运用Referencer的各项功能,本文提供了丰富的代码示例,旨在增强文章的实用性和可操作性。通过详尽的示例指导,即便是初学者也能快速上手,高效地管理自己的文献资源。

关键词

Referencer, Gnome, 文献管理, 代码示例, 实用性

一、了解 Referencer

1.1 什么是 Referencer?

在学术研究与写作的过程中,文献管理是一项必不可少的工作。Referencer 应运而生,作为一款专为 Gnome 桌面环境设计的文献管理软件,它不仅简化了文献收集、整理的过程,还极大地提升了用户的效率。Referencer 的界面简洁直观,操作流畅,使得用户可以轻松地集中精力于研究本身,而不是被繁琐的文献管理工作所困扰。

1.2 Referencer 的主要特点

Referencer 的设计初衷是为用户提供一个高效、便捷的文献管理工具。以下是其几个显著的特点:

  • 集成性:Referencer 无缝集成于 Gnome 桌面环境中,这意味着用户无需离开当前的工作环境即可完成文献管理的所有操作。这种集成性不仅提高了工作效率,还减少了因频繁切换应用程序而带来的干扰。
  • 强大的搜索功能:Referencer 提供了强大的搜索功能,支持全文检索以及标签分类等多种方式。无论文献数量多少,用户都能迅速找到所需的信息,大大节省了查找文献的时间。
  • 灵活的引用管理:对于学术研究者而言,准确无误地引用文献至关重要。Referencer 支持多种引用格式,并且可以根据不同的出版要求自定义引用样式,确保引用的准确性与一致性。
  • 详尽的代码示例:为了让用户更好地理解和应用 Referencer 的各项功能,软件内置了丰富的代码示例。这些示例覆盖了从基本操作到高级功能的各个方面,即使是初学者也能通过实践快速上手,从而更加高效地管理自己的文献资源。

通过这些特点可以看出,Referencer 不仅仅是一款简单的文献管理工具,更是一个能够帮助用户提高工作效率、优化工作流程的强大助手。

二、Referencer 入门指南

2.1 安装 Referencer

Referencer 的安装过程简单直观,即便是初次接触这款软件的新用户也能轻松完成。下面将详细介绍如何在 Gnome 桌面环境下安装 Referencer,确保每位用户都能顺利开始使用这款强大的文献管理工具。

2.1.1 通过软件中心安装

对于大多数 Gnome 用户来说,最简便的方式是通过 Gnome 软件中心进行安装。只需打开软件中心,在搜索框中输入“Referencer”,点击安装按钮,系统便会自动下载并安装最新版本的 Referencer。这种方式不仅方便快捷,还能确保用户获得官方提供的最新稳定版本。

2.1.2 使用命令行安装

对于喜欢使用命令行的用户,可以通过终端执行以下命令来安装 Referencer:

sudo apt-get update
sudo apt-get install referencer

这两条命令首先更新了系统的软件包列表,然后安装了 Referencer。这种方式适合那些希望对安装过程有更多控制权的用户。

无论是通过软件中心还是命令行安装,Referencer 都能在几分钟内准备就绪,等待用户探索其丰富的功能。

2.2 Referencer 的基本操作

一旦 Referencer 安装完毕,用户就可以开始体验它的强大功能了。接下来,我们将介绍一些基本的操作步骤,帮助新用户快速上手。

2.2.1 添加文献

添加文献是使用 Referencer 的第一步。用户可以通过导入 BibTeX 文件、手动输入或直接从在线数据库中搜索并添加文献。Referencer 支持多种文献格式,确保用户能够轻松地将现有文献库导入软件中。

2.2.2 管理文献

Referencer 提供了直观的界面来管理文献。用户可以创建文件夹来组织文献,使用标签进行分类,甚至可以通过全文搜索快速定位特定文献。这些功能使得文献管理变得更加有序和高效。

2.2.3 引用文献

在撰写论文或报告时,正确引用文献至关重要。Referencer 提供了多种引用格式的选择,并允许用户根据具体需求自定义引用样式。只需几下点击,就能在文档中插入准确的引用信息,极大地简化了引用管理的过程。

通过以上步骤,用户可以快速掌握 Referencer 的基本操作。随着对软件的深入了解,用户还将发现更多高级功能,如协作共享、笔记记录等,进一步提升文献管理的效率和质量。

三、文献管理基础

3.1 创建文献库

在学术研究的旅途中,建立一个有序且易于访问的文献库是至关重要的第一步。Referencer 以其直观的设计和强大的功能,让这一过程变得既简单又高效。想象一下,当你坐在电脑前,面对着一片空白的文档,心中充满了对知识的渴望,却苦于找不到合适的文献来源时,Referencer 就像是一位智慧的向导,引领你穿越文献的海洋,找到那片属于你的宝藏之地。

3.1.1 初始化文献库

启动 Referencer 后,用户首先需要创建一个新的文献库。这一步骤就像是为即将展开的学术之旅铺设基石。在 Referencer 的主界面上,点击“新建文献库”按钮,选择一个合适的位置保存文献库文件。这个简单的动作,标志着你即将踏上一段充满发现与创造的旅程。

3.1.2 组织文献库

创建好文献库后,接下来的任务就是组织文献。Referencer 提供了多种方式来帮助用户整理文献,比如创建文件夹、添加标签等。这些功能不仅让文献库看起来井井有条,更重要的是,它们能够帮助用户在需要的时候迅速找到所需的文献。想象一下,在一个阳光明媚的下午,你坐在书桌前,手指轻点鼠标,一个个文件夹和标签就像是一张张通往知识世界的地图,指引着你探索未知的领域。

3.2 添加文献 sources

有了一个结构清晰的文献库之后,下一步就是填充它。Referencer 提供了多种方法来添加文献,无论是手动输入、导入文件还是直接从在线数据库中搜索,都能轻松实现。

3.2.1 手动输入文献信息

对于那些珍贵的手稿或是难以获取的文献,手动输入文献信息是一种不错的选择。在 Referencer 中,只需点击“添加文献”按钮,便可以开始录入相关信息。尽管这可能需要一些时间,但每一条精心录入的数据都是对你学术热情的见证。

3.2.2 导入 BibTeX 文件

对于已有大量文献积累的研究者来说,导入 BibTeX 文件是一种更为高效的方法。只需轻轻一点,Referencer 就能读取文件中的所有信息,并将其整齐地排列在文献库中。这种便捷的操作,就像是为你的文献库添砖加瓦,使其更加坚固和丰富。

3.2.3 从在线数据库中搜索并添加文献

在互联网时代,许多学术资源都可以在线获取。Referencer 支持直接从多个在线数据库中搜索文献,并一键添加到文献库中。这种功能不仅节省了时间,还极大地扩展了文献库的范围。每当成功添加一篇文献时,就像是在知识的海洋中又多了一颗璀璨的明珠,照亮了前行的道路。

通过上述步骤,用户可以轻松地创建并填充一个功能齐全的文献库。在这个过程中,Referencer 不仅是一个工具,更像是一个伙伴,陪伴着你在学术的道路上不断前行。

四、高效文献搜索

4.1 使用 Referencer 进行文献搜索

在学术研究的世界里,寻找合适的文献就如同在茫茫大海中寻找灯塔,指引着研究的方向。Referencer 以其强大的搜索功能,成为了这一过程中的得力助手。想象一下,当夜幕降临,你坐在电脑前,心中充满了对知识的渴望,却苦于找不到合适的文献来源时,Referencer 就像是一位智慧的向导,引领你穿越文献的海洋,找到那片属于你的宝藏之地。

4.1.1 利用关键词搜索

Referencer 的搜索功能支持基于关键词的全文检索。用户只需输入相关的关键词,软件便会迅速筛选出匹配的文献。这种高效的搜索方式,就像是在知识的海洋中撒下一张巨大的网,捕捉到那些最为珍贵的信息。

4.1.2 根据标签分类

除了关键词搜索外,Referencer 还支持通过标签进行分类。用户可以为每篇文献添加多个标签,这样在需要时,只需点击相应的标签,就能快速找到相关文献。这种分类方式,就像是为每一篇文献贴上了专属的标签,让它们在文献库中各得其所。

4.1.3 利用在线数据库

Referencer 还支持直接从多个在线数据库中搜索文献。用户只需输入关键词,软件便会自动连接到各大数据库,搜索相关的文献信息。这种功能不仅节省了时间,还极大地扩展了文献库的范围。每当成功添加一篇文献时,就像是在知识的海洋中又多了一颗璀璨的明珠,照亮了前行的道路。

4.2 文献搜索技巧

掌握了 Referencer 的基本搜索功能后,接下来就需要学习一些高级技巧,以便更高效地利用这款强大的工具。

4.2.1 使用布尔运算符

在进行文献搜索时,合理运用布尔运算符(AND、OR、NOT)可以大大提高搜索的精确度。例如,输入 "machine learning AND deep learning" 可以找到同时包含这两个关键词的文献,而 "machine learning OR deep learning" 则能找到包含任一关键词的文献。这种技巧,就像是在搜索的道路上铺设了一条明确的路径,引导你直达目的地。

4.2.2 利用引号进行精确匹配

当需要精确匹配某个短语时,可以在关键词周围加上引号。例如,搜索 "climate change" 会找到包含这个完整短语的文献,而不是分别包含 "climate" 和 "change" 的文献。这种技巧,就像是为你的搜索请求穿上了一层保护衣,确保每一次搜索都能得到最精准的结果。

4.2.3 结合使用标签和关键词

结合使用标签和关键词进行搜索,可以进一步缩小搜索范围,找到更加符合需求的文献。例如,如果你正在研究机器学习在医疗领域的应用,可以尝试搜索 "medical AND machine learning" 并结合使用 "medical" 标签,这样就能找到更加精准的文献。这种技巧,就像是在文献的海洋中点亮了一盏明灯,照亮了你前进的方向。

通过上述技巧的学习和实践,用户可以更加高效地利用 Referencer 进行文献搜索,为自己的学术研究之路铺平道路。

五、Referencer 实践指南

5.1 Referencer 的代码示例

在 Referencer 中,代码示例是帮助用户更好地理解并掌握软件功能的关键。下面,我们将通过几个具体的代码示例来展示如何使用 Referencer 的一些重要特性。

示例 1: 添加文献

假设你需要手动添加一篇文献,可以使用以下命令:

referencer add --title "The Impact of Machine Learning on Healthcare" --author "John Doe" --year 2023 --journal "Journal of Medical Informatics"

这条命令将创建一篇标题为“The Impact of Machine Learning on Healthcare”的文献,作者为“John Doe”,发表年份为2023年,并收录于“Journal of Medical Informatics”。

示例 2: 导入 BibTeX 文件

如果你有一份 BibTeX 文件,可以使用以下命令将其导入 Referencer:

referencer import --file /path/to/your/bibtex/file.bib

这条命令将把位于指定路径下的 BibTeX 文件导入到你的文献库中。

示例 3: 搜索文献

Referencer 提供了强大的搜索功能,你可以使用以下命令来搜索包含特定关键词的文献:

referencer search --query "machine learning"

这条命令将搜索包含“machine learning”关键词的所有文献。

示例 4: 引用文献

在撰写论文时,正确引用文献至关重要。Referencer 支持多种引用格式,你可以使用以下命令来生成引用:

referencer cite --id 1234 --format apa

这条命令将生成编号为 1234 的文献的 APA 格式的引用。

5.2 代码示例解析

通过上述示例,我们可以更深入地了解 Referencer 的一些关键功能及其使用方法。

  • 添加文献:通过简单的命令行操作,用户可以快速添加新的文献条目。这对于经常需要手动添加文献的研究人员来说非常有用。
  • 导入 BibTeX 文件:对于已经有大量文献积累的用户,通过导入 BibTeX 文件可以极大地提高效率,避免重复劳动。
  • 搜索文献:强大的搜索功能可以帮助用户快速定位到所需的文献,无论是基于关键词还是其他条件,都能迅速找到目标文献。
  • 引用文献:正确的引用格式对于学术研究至关重要。Referencer 支持多种引用格式,确保用户能够准确无误地引用文献,满足不同出版物的要求。

这些代码示例不仅展示了 Referencer 的强大功能,也为用户提供了实际操作的指南,帮助他们在日常工作中更加高效地管理和利用文献资源。

六、Referencer 故障排除

6.1 Referencer 的常见问题

在使用 Referencer 的过程中,用户可能会遇到一些常见的问题。这些问题虽然看似简单,但对于初次接触这款软件的新用户来说,可能会成为不小的障碍。下面列举了一些较为普遍的问题,帮助用户提前了解并做好准备。

问题 1: 如何解决 Referencer 无法启动的问题?

有些用户反映,在尝试启动 Referencer 时遇到了困难,软件无法正常启动。这种情况可能是由于系统兼容性问题或软件安装不完全导致的。

问题 2: 导入 BibTeX 文件时出现错误怎么办?

在导入 BibTeX 文件的过程中,有时会出现格式不匹配或数据丢失等问题,导致文献信息无法正确显示。

问题 3: 如何处理搜索功能不准确的情况?

尽管 Referencer 的搜索功能十分强大,但在某些情况下,用户可能会发现搜索结果并不如预期般准确。

问题 4: 引用格式不符合要求怎么办?

在撰写论文时,如果发现 Referencer 生成的引用格式与期刊要求不符,可能会给用户带来一定的困扰。

6.2 问题解决方法

针对上述提到的问题,我们提供了一系列解决方案,帮助用户轻松应对挑战,确保 Referencer 的使用体验顺畅无阻。

解决方案 1: 解决 Referencer 无法启动的问题

  • 检查系统兼容性:确保你的操作系统版本与 Referencer 的最低要求相匹配。通常,Referencer 需要在 Gnome 桌面环境下运行,因此请确认你的桌面环境是否为 Gnome。
  • 重新安装:有时候,软件安装过程中可能出现问题。尝试卸载并重新安装 Referencer,确保所有组件都已正确安装。

解决方案 2: 解决导入 BibTeX 文件时出现错误的问题

  • 检查文件格式:确保 BibTeX 文件格式正确无误。可以使用文本编辑器打开文件,检查是否有明显的格式错误。
  • 使用官方模板:如果可能的话,使用 Referencer 提供的官方 BibTeX 文件模板来创建或转换文件,以确保兼容性。

解决方案 3: 处理搜索功能不准确的情况

  • 细化搜索关键词:尝试使用更具体的关键词进行搜索,或者结合使用布尔运算符(AND、OR、NOT)来缩小搜索范围。
  • 检查标签设置:确保为文献添加了适当的标签,并尝试使用标签进行搜索。

解决方案 4: 解决引用格式不符合要求的问题

  • 自定义引用样式:Referencer 支持自定义引用格式。在设置菜单中,选择“引用样式”,根据期刊的具体要求调整引用格式。
  • 联系技术支持:如果问题仍然存在,可以考虑联系 Referencer 的技术支持团队寻求帮助。他们通常会提供详细的指导和支持。

通过上述解决方案,用户可以有效地解决在使用 Referencer 过程中遇到的各种问题,确保文献管理工作的顺利进行。无论是新手还是经验丰富的用户,都能从中受益,享受到 Referencer 带来的便利与高效。

七、总结

通过本文的详细介绍,读者不仅对 Referencer 有了全面的认识,还学会了如何利用这款强大的文献管理工具来提高学术研究的效率。从安装配置到日常使用,再到高级功能的应用,Referencer 为用户提供了全方位的支持。丰富的代码示例更是让初学者也能快速上手,通过实践掌握各项功能。无论是文献的添加、管理、搜索还是引用,Referencer 都展现出了其卓越的能力。此外,针对使用过程中可能遇到的问题,本文也提供了实用的解决方案,确保用户能够顺畅地使用 Referencer。总之,Referencer 不仅仅是一款文献管理软件,更是每位研究者不可或缺的得力助手。